Нужно срочно написать советника по ТЗ

MQL5 Experts

Job finished

Execution time 8 days
Feedback from customer
все нормально, выполнил в срок и качественно
Feedback from employee
Хороший заказчик. Обращайтесь снова)

Specification

терминал метатрейдер 5 

к нему написать программу к торговле советник, программа при установке будет запускать алогоритм действий.

при старте советника в 20 пунктах от цены выставляется buy stop заявка вверху, и sell стоп в 20 внизу 

пара евро доллар 
график минутный 

При активации стоп ордера ставится стоп лосс 1000 пунктов


пункт а

при росте на 20 пунктов
включается трейлинг стоп в 20 пунктах от цены

пункт б 
происходит покупка одной позиции по рынку при росте цены и там же устанавливается к позиции стоп лосс 1000 пунктов


пункт в

ставится sell стоп в 20 пунктах от цены
там же где стоит стоп лосс

УБРАТЬ ВСЕ БАЙ СЕЛЛ СТОПА И УСТАНОВИТЬ НОВЫЙ 1 СЕЛЛ СТОП В 20 ПУНКТОВ



пункт 4 

если нет ни одной позиции по рынку то снова buy стоп вверху от 20 и внизу sellстоп тоже 20 пунктов


пункт 5 все тоже самое и в противоположном направлении КОГДА ЦЕНА РАЗВОРАЧИВАЕТСЯ ТОЖЕ САМОЕ ДЛЯ БАЙ И ДЛЯ СЕЛЛ


пункт 6
при удвоении средств удваивается лотность

если собралось  больше 10 убыточных ордеров либо бай либо селл, то лотность так же удваивается при условии что маржи больше 500 процента, если меньше то не вывполняется

при этом увелечсиваеся лотность 


пункт 7 
если на стоп лосс ставится - 5 процентов ( от средств) от максимума
то закрыть все позиции , и не торгуется до 2:10 следующего дня

пункт 8 
при 50 убыточных ордерах и депозимте в 10к долларов лотность 0,05, если убыточных ордеров снова 8 то лотность 0,01 лота, а если средства уже 20 к то 0,02 лота при 8 ордерах (пример)



metacod аналог с++

Files:

TXT
T.txt
2.3 Kb

Responded

1
Developer 1
Rating
(2)
Projects
4
0%
Arbitration
2
0% / 50%
Overdue
1
25%
Working
1
Developer 1
Rating
(13)
Projects
31
23%
Arbitration
7
29% / 57%
Overdue
5
16%
Working
2
Developer 2
Rating
(64)
Projects
144
46%
Arbitration
20
40% / 15%
Overdue
32
22%
Working
3
Developer 3
Rating
(92)
Projects
110
17%
Arbitration
6
33% / 17%
Overdue
5
5%
Free
Published: 1 code
4
Developer 4
Rating
(632)
Projects
852
48%
Arbitration
29
38% / 17%
Overdue
63
7%
Working
5
Developer 5
Rating
(473)
Projects
1139
44%
Arbitration
51
31% / 33%
Overdue
501
44%
Free
6
Developer 6
Rating
(618)
Projects
1428
59%
Arbitration
31
81% / 0%
Overdue
10
1%
Free
7
Developer 7
Rating
(112)
Projects
132
56%
Arbitration
1
0% / 0%
Overdue
0
Free
8
Developer 8
Rating
(45)
Projects
64
28%
Arbitration
0
Overdue
6
9%
Free
9
Developer 9
Rating
(553)
Projects
640
33%
Arbitration
41
41% / 46%
Overdue
11
2%
Loaded
10
Developer 10
Rating
(79)
Projects
137
51%
Arbitration
5
80% / 0%
Overdue
6
4%
Working
11
Developer 11
Rating
(355)
Projects
426
54%
Arbitration
20
55% / 15%
Overdue
29
7%
Loaded
Similar orders
Требуется создать советник на основе разворотных паттернов, используя дополнительные индикаторы такие как скользящее среднее, отклонение от скользящей средней, угол наклона скользящей средней. Возможно будет добавлено что то еще по ходу работы
Суть ТС:Приход в POI старшего тф, вход в позицию на младшем тф Анализ графика начинается всегда со старшего тф. Должен быть понятный контекст для работы. Активы: EURUSD, XAUUSD POI старшего таймфрейма: Liquidity (1M, 1W, 1D, 4H, 1H) Imbalance (1M, 1W, 1D, 4H, 1H) Order Block (1M, 1W, 1D, 4H, 1H) HTF Fractals (1M, 1W, 1D, 4H, 1H) Всегда дожидаться цену в POI старшего таймфрейма. Вход в позицию: Слом LTF структуры на
к примеру 10 стратегий выстреливают одновременно в одну и ту же милисекунду при открытие бара надо их сделать последовательными один за другим, с проверкой, что предыдущий ордер был открыт и модифицирован SL TP оредра могут быть отложенные и маркет пока один ордер исполняется другие ждут в очереди так как используется ММ настоящий баланс double Total_Current_Risk() { double res = 0; for (int i = 0; i <

Project information

Budget
50 - 130 USD
Deadline
from 3 to 10 day(s)